Understanding Payout Speeds and What “Fast Cashout” Really Means
Payout speed is the true test of a casino’s respect for your time, yet “fast cashout” often hides a maze of fine print. When a site claims instant withdrawals, check if that applies to e-wallets only, while cards and bank transfers drag for days. The real benchmark is the pending time before approval—that’s where delays sneak in, from 24-hour manual reviews to weekend freezes. Always compare the processing window, not just the advertised method, because crypto and PayPal might clear in hours, whereas a Visa payout can take five business days. Ultimately, a genuinely fast cashout means your verified account, wagering-free balance, and chosen method align perfectly—otherwise, the speed is just a headline.

Bonus Wagering Requirements Explained in Plain English
Bonus wagering requirements, often called playthrough, dictate how many times you must bet the bonus amount before withdrawing winnings. A 30x requirement on a $100 bonus means wagering $3,000 total. Crucially, not all games contribute equally—slots typically count 100%, while blackjack or roulette might count only 10% or 0%, stretching your effective playthrough dramatically. Always check the contribution percentages before you spin, or your “free” cash becomes a trap. The clock also matters: most bonuses expire within 7–30 days, so calculate your average bet size to see if clearing is realistic. Smart bonus hunters prioritize low wagering multipliers alongside high contribution rates, not just the biggest headline offer.
- Look for wagering requirements of 20x or lower on bonus plus deposit.
- Confirm max bet per spin (often $5) while meeting playthrough—exceeding it voids the bonus.
- Review game restrictions; slots-only or live-casino-excluded terms change your strategy completely.

How to Identify High RTP Games on Any Casino Lobby
To identify high RTP games on any casino lobby, first open a slot’s info or paytable screen—most providers list the theoretical return there. Filter the lobby by “RTP” if the site offers that sorting option; otherwise, check the game’s help section before spinning. For table games, choose variants like European roulette (97.30%) over American (94.74%)—the difference is visible in the rules. Live dealer lobbies often display RTP next to the betting limits; if missing, search the provider’s official site for the certified figure. Finally, avoid “progressive jackpot” slots unless the base RTP is explicitly stated, as their pooled contributions lower the return. **Always verify RTP from the game’s own menu rather than third-party lists**, since lobbies occasionally mislabel versions.

Progressive Jackpots vs. Fixed Wins—Choosing Your Risk Level
When choosing between progressive jackpots and fixed wins, your risk tolerance dictates the strategy. Progressive slots pool a fraction of every bet into a massive prize, offering life-changing payouts but with lower base-game return rates and slimmer odds of hitting the top tier. Fixed wins, by contrast, provide predictable, frequent payouts tied to a multiplier of your stake, allowing precise bankroll management and longer sessions. For most players, a hybrid approach works best: allocate a small portion of your budget to progressive jackpot chasing for the thrill, while the majority stays on fixed-win games to ensure steady, realistic returns. Never chase a jackpot beyond your loss limit, as the house edge compounds with each spin.

Recognizing Fair Play Features: Randomness, Audit Trails, and Transparent Rules
To protect your bankroll, verify that a casino’s games use certified random number generators (RNGs), which ensure each outcome is independent and unpredictable. Before depositing, check for a published audit trail—ideally from independent testers like eCOGRA—that confirms payout percentages and game fairness. Likewise, look for transparent rules displayed directly in the game’s info tab, covering bet limits, return-to-player rates, and bonus wagering conditions. Even a visually flawless slot can hide unfavorable mechanics if its RNG certificate is outdated or its house edge is buried in fine print. Prioritize platforms that let you access these documents without support requests. Ultimately, recognizing fair play features before wagering prevents surprise losses and aligns your stake size with the game’s true volatility, keeping your session budget intact.
